Description:
Gene Autry explains the story behind his song: He's on the verge of leaving his job as a county attorney investigator to start a cattle business with Chuckawalla Jones, but changes his mind to help Anne Lawson prove her father, rancher Ralph Lawson, didn't commit murder. Gene searches for three witnesses who can testify that Lawson acted in self-defense when he killed a gambler. However, the witnesses are intimidated by Rock McCleary, a powerful town figure, who shoots one of them, Pop Roberts Morgan. Before dying from his wounds, Pop gives Gene the crucial information needed to clear Lawson, whispering that the "Ghost Riders" are coming for him. Gene then prepares for a confrontation with McCleary.
